Job Description:
We are seeking a highly skilled and detail-oriented Property Claims Consultant to join our dynamic claims team. In this role, you will be responsible for managing property claims from end-to-end, working across a diverse portfolio that includes both intermediated and direct customers.
This is an excellent opportunity for someone who thrives in a fast-paced environment, enjoys problem-solving, and is committed to delivering exceptional customer service. You will play a key role in ensuring claims are handled efficiently, professionally, and in line with compliance standards.
- Accurately assess and manage property claims in accordance with company policies and industry regulations.
- Handle claims efficiently within agreed workflow timeframes and service level agreements (SLAs).
- Proactively manage claim lifecycles through diary management and vendor coordination.
- Respond to customer complaints and expressions of dissatisfaction with empathy and professionalism.
- Manage incoming call enquiries, providing clear and timely support to customers and stakeholders.
- Conduct regular claims reviews and assist with overflow claims from other sub-teams as needed.
To be successful in this role, you will need the following skills and qualifications:
- 3–5 years of experience in property claims handling.
- Strong customer service skills with the ability to adapt communication to different customer groups.
- Excellent problem-solving and decision-making abilities.
- Proven time management and organisational skills.
- Familiarity with regulatory compliance in the insurance industry.
- Experience working with external vendors such as repairers, assessors, and brokers.
